A soft drink manufacturer wants to minimise the amount of aluminium in its cans while still holding 375 mL of soft drink. Given that 375 mL has a volume of 375cm^3
a. show that the surface area of a can is given by s= 2pier^2 + 750/r
b. find the radius of the can that gives the minimum surface area.
